Biography: Daniel Lerman, MD is a board-certified, fellowship-trained orthopedic surgeon who specializes in the care of patients with benign and malignant tumors of the bone and soft tissue. His clinical expertise includes limb-sparing surgery, sarcoma surgery, and the treatment of complex musculoskeletal conditions, such as pathologic fractures, amputee care, and complex total joint reconstructions.Dr. Lerman earned his medical degree at the University of Maryland School of Medicine. He completed his residency in Orthopedic Surgery at NYU Hospital for Joint Diseases and then a fellowship in Orthopedic Oncology at the University of Utah™s Huntsman Cancer Institute. He has authored numerous peer-reviewed scientific articles, reviews articles and book chapters on the topics of sarcoma therapy and metastatic bone disease. He continues to present his research at national and international conferences. Dr. Lerman is engaged in multiple national research projects and is a Diplomat of the American Board of Orthopaedic Surgery, and a member of the American Academy of Orthopaedic Surgeons, Musculoskeletal Tumor Society and Connective Tissue Oncology Society. He reviews scientific articles for Journal of Surgical Oncology and Clinical Orthopaedics and Related Research.In addition to his clinical responsibilities, Dr. Lerman serves as the Director of Sarcoma for the Institute of Limb Preservation, the Managing Partner of the Colorado Limb Consultants, and volunteers his time as a member of the Board of Directors Executive Committee for the Limb Preservation Foundation.
